Bitcoin mining is a fascinating system that requires substantial computational power to verify and add transactions to the blockchain. Miners compete against each other to solve complex mathematical puzzles, with the successful solver being rewarded with newly minted Bitcoin. This intricate mechanism is vital for maintaining the security and integrity of the Bitcoin network, while also driving its growth and decentralization.
The requirement for powerful hardware and high energy consumption has led to ongoing discussion surrounding the environmental impact of Bitcoin mining. However, advancements in technology are constantly appearing, with strategies being explored to mitigate these concerns. From renewable energy sources to more efficient mining techniques, the future of Bitcoin mining holds both opportunity for increased sustainability and scalability.

Choosing the Right Bitcoin Mining Hardware for Success
Embarking on your Bitcoin mining journey requires careful consideration of hardware. The optimal mining rig depends on your budget, power consumption requirements, and desired hashing speed.
A common selection for beginners is an ASICminer, specifically designed for Bitcoin mining. These specialized processors offer exceptional hash powers but can be pricey.
Moreover, consider the cooling system, as mining generates significant heat. Guarantee your rig has adequate read more ventilation to prevent overheating and malfunction.

The Future of copyright Mining: Sustainability and Innovation
As thecopyright space continues to evolve, extraction practices are facing increasing scrutiny regarding their environmental impact. The energy utilization associated with traditional mining methods has raised concerns about sustainability. However, the future of copyright mining holdspromise for both environmental responsibility and technological innovation.
- Engineers are actively exploring renewable energy sources to power mining operations, such as solar, wind, and hydroelectric power.
- Proof-of-Stakevalidation mechanisms, which require significantly less energy than traditional proof-of-work systems, are gaining traction.
- Reduced-consumption hardware is constantly being developed, further minimizing the environmental footprint of mining.
These advancements, coupled with growing awareness of the need for sustainable practices within the digital asset} industry, suggest a future where copyright mining can co-exist harmoniously with the environment.
